“There is a well in the parish of Terryglass named St Roche's well.”
(ar lean ón leathanach roimhe)had lost his sight. St Roche was told by an aparition to scratch the ground with his hands and rub the clay to his eyes. Immediately he got his sight back again. And where he scratched the ground there a well appeared and he could see his own two eyes he had at first in the bottom of it. From that on, there was a lot cured who had sore eyes. It is generally called the eye well.- Bailitheoir
